Transaction 485441891cde67d5d7bd59c194764043b3891d0a25ffd66e181bbf7bfcfce5ae

1 Input
2 Outputs
  • 485441891cde67d5d7bd59c194764043b3891d0a25ffd66e181bbf7bfcfce5ae:0
  • value  552109
    address  123PrWBTA2UwgfRRMbokdpYa9tcVKG4ZaF
  • 485441891cde67d5d7bd59c194764043b3891d0a25ffd66e181bbf7bfcfce5ae:1
  • value  17306094
    address  1LZvC7HEWrLFzkw3XQJdu6S2wZNMgkmAsd